Uniaxial geogrid is a type of geosynthetic material designed to reinforce soil and other granular materials. It consists of a polymer grid with long, strong ribs that are oriented in a single direction (uniaxial). This configuration provides high tensile strength and is used primarily for soil stabilization, reinforcement, and load distribution.
